Mountain Goat Success Rates

Rifle72%
Historical success rates for mountain goat in Unit G03 are available on the CPW Big Game Statistics portal and are summarized in the Draw Odds chart on this page. Review multi-year trends rather than single-season numbers before planning a hunt.

Mountain Goat Draw Odds

SeasonTagsApplicantsDraw %Pts Req
Rifle— 1st Season171,0681.6% 3
Rifle— 2nd Season176102.8% 3

Data from 2025 draw results. Resident odds shown.
